Ignazio E. D' Amico, 90, of Hopelawn died Monday, December 13, 2010, at the Raritan Bay Medical Center, Perth Amboy.
He was born in Chester, Pennsylvania. He was formerly of Perth Amboy and moved to Hopelawn 13 years ago. Ignazio
was employed with the U.S Government working as a Supervisor in the Shipping Department at the Raritan Arsenal in Edison for 31 years before retiring in 1970. He was a communicant of Most Holy Rosary RC Church in Hopelawn and was an avid rollerskater and dancer. He served in the Army during WW II.
Ignazio was predeceased by his sister, Catherine Zegalik on December 1st. Surviving are his brother, Samuel D'Amico of Hopelawn; his sister, Rose Baginsky of Toms River; and many nieces and nephews.
